#ifndef CUDADataFormats_RecHits_TrackingRecHitsUtilities_h
#define CUDADataFormats_RecHits_TrackingRecHitsUtilities_h
#include <Eigen/Dense>
#include "Geometry/CommonTopologies/interface/SimplePixelTopology.h"
#include "HeterogeneousCore/CUDAUtilities/interface/HistoContainer.h"
#include "DataFormats/SoATemplate/interface/SoALayout.h"
#include "RecoLocalTracker/SiPixelRecHits/interface/pixelCPEforGPU.h"
#include "HeterogeneousCore/CUDAUtilities/interface/host_unique_ptr.h"
#include "SiPixelHitStatus.h"
template <typename TrackerTraits>
struct TrackingRecHitSoA {
using hindex_type = typename TrackerTraits::hindex_type;
using PhiBinner = cms::cuda::HistoContainer<int16_t,
256,
-1,
8 * sizeof(int16_t),
hindex_type,
TrackerTraits::numberOfLayers>; //28 for phase2 geometry
using PhiBinnerStorageType = typename PhiBinner::index_type;
using AverageGeometry = pixelTopology::AverageGeometryT<TrackerTraits>;
using ParamsOnGPU = pixelCPEforGPU::ParamsOnGPUT<TrackerTraits>;
using HitLayerStartArray = std::array<hindex_type, TrackerTraits::numberOfLayers + 1>;
using HitModuleStartArray = std::array<hindex_type, TrackerTraits::numberOfModules + 1>;
//Is it better to have two split?
GENERATE_SOA_LAYOUT(TrackingRecHitSoALayout,
SOA_COLUMN(float, xLocal),
SOA_COLUMN(float, yLocal),
SOA_COLUMN(float, xerrLocal),
SOA_COLUMN(float, yerrLocal),
SOA_COLUMN(float, xGlobal),
SOA_COLUMN(float, yGlobal),
SOA_COLUMN(float, zGlobal),
SOA_COLUMN(float, rGlobal),
SOA_COLUMN(int16_t, iphi),
SOA_COLUMN(SiPixelHitStatusAndCharge, chargeAndStatus),
SOA_COLUMN(int16_t, clusterSizeX),
SOA_COLUMN(int16_t, clusterSizeY),
SOA_COLUMN(uint16_t, detectorIndex),
SOA_SCALAR(uint32_t, nHits),
SOA_SCALAR(int32_t, offsetBPIX2),
//These above could be separated in a specific
//layout since they don't depends on the template
//for the moment I'm keeping them here
SOA_COLUMN(PhiBinnerStorageType, phiBinnerStorage),
SOA_SCALAR(HitModuleStartArray, hitsModuleStart),
SOA_SCALAR(HitLayerStartArray, hitsLayerStart),
SOA_SCALAR(ParamsOnGPU, cpeParams),
SOA_SCALAR(AverageGeometry, averageGeometry),
SOA_SCALAR(PhiBinner, phiBinner));
};
template <typename TrackerTraits>
using TrackingRecHitLayout = typename TrackingRecHitSoA<TrackerTraits>::template TrackingRecHitSoALayout<>;
template <typename TrackerTraits>
using TrackingRecHitSoAView = typename TrackingRecHitSoA<TrackerTraits>::template TrackingRecHitSoALayout<>::View;
template <typename TrackerTraits>
using TrackingRecHitSoAConstView =
typename TrackingRecHitSoA<TrackerTraits>::template TrackingRecHitSoALayout<>::ConstView;
#endif
